Frometa, Woodall Added to Bombs Away 5

Night of boxing set for April 2 at the Bayfront Hilton.

ST. PETERSBURG, FL – Unbeaten junior welterweight Yordan “Cuba” Frometa and middleweight prospect Steed “The Stallion” Woodall have been added to the Bombs Away 5 boxing card for Saturday, April 2 at the Bayfront Hilton, 333 First St. S.

Frometa, a native of Pinar del Rio, Cuba, will put his 7-0 record on the line against Farkhad “Crazy Russian” Sharipov of Kissimmee in a six-round bout. Frometa, known for his six knockouts in his seven bouts, won both the U-17 and junior world championships as part of Cuba’s world renowned amateur program.

Born in the United Kingdom and now living in Miami, Woodall started his boxing career 9-0-1 with six knockouts. In his last fight, Woodall fought on ShoBox: The New Generation for the NABF title but was stopped in the fourth round by Steve Rolls. He will face Juan Fernando Reya of Bolivia.

“I’m glad we were able to add two more quality fighters to the card,” said Joey Orduna of Mad Integrity Fight Sports. “The locals were already raving about other fights on the card and now there’s even more to be excited about.”

Other matches on the 10-fight card will include:

  • Ari Tareh, 13-11-5 (6 KOs) of Tampa vs. Juan Aguirre, 6-16-1, of Jacksonville, eight rounds, welterweight
  • Jose “Lil’ Pacquiao” Resendez, 4-0 (2 KOs) of St. Petersburg vs. Raul Chirino, 7-1 (3 KOs), six rounds, featherweight
  • Armando “The Gentleman” Alvarez, 8-0, of Miami vs. Lee “Holliwood” Dawson, 2-2-3), welterweight
  • Michael Guillen, 1-0, of Port Orange vs. Rafael Rivera, 2-2-3, of Tampa, junior lightweight
  • Viktor Kulakovski, 4-2, of St. Petersburg vs. Paulie Simpson, 2-1, of Tampa, welterweight

Also appearing on the fight card:

  • “King” Kenmon Evans, 2-0, of New Smyrna Beach, light heavyweight
  • Raynard Hill, 5-10, of Winter Haven, middleweight
  • Jose Medina, 1-0, of Winter Haven, heavyweight
